DIGAWEL Offers a Final Look at its Spring/Summer '26 Collection Ahead of its Release

As DIGAWEL releases the last of its Autumn/Winter ‘25 stock, the final veil has been lifted on its Spring/Summer ‘26 collection, which is based on archetypal American style from an Italian perspective.

Instead of consistently honing in on one area for inspiration, DIGAWEL pivots each season. Spring/Summer ‘26 is no different, building it around American casual wear seen through Italian eyes. Instead of a radical shift, DIGAWEL aims to bring a subtle change to familiar silhouettes, from shirts to trousers, sweatshirts to jackets.

DIGAEL cites 1980s American vintage clothing that landed in Italy as a starting place for the collection. American collegiate or sportswear would arrive in Italy, and BD shirts or reverse-weave sweatshirts would receive over-the-top and unnecessary styling enhancements. An ordinary Oxford button-down shirt would be transformed into an outrageously casual shirt, far removed from its origins, making it feel new. This spirit is channelled throughout the collection but toned down slightly to suit the brand’s distinct aesthetic. Half-zip sweatshirts feature stripes on the sleeve and hem bands, open-collar shirts are decidedly boxy, basketball shorts sit below the knee, tailoring is adjusted to be casual for daily wear, and sweat pants are cut wider than usual.
